Potential energy is stored energy and the energy of position.

  • Chemical energy is energy stored in the bonds of atoms and molecules.
  • Mechanical energy is energy stored in objects by tension.
  • Nuclear energy is energy stored in the nucleus of an atom—the energy that holds the nucleus together.

      What are the 4 types of energy do humans have?

      In the body, thermal energy helps us to maintain a constant body temperature, mechanical energy helps us to move, and electrical energy sends nerve impulses and fires signals to and from our brains. Energy is stored in foods and in the body as chemical energy.

      Where does the energy in matter come from?

      There is kinetic energy in objects that are moving. The molecules making up all matter contains a huge amount of energy, as Einstein’s E = mc ^2 pointed out to us. Energy can also travel in the form of electromagnetic waves, such as heat, light, radio, and gamma rays.

      Which is the correct formula for the work energy theorem?

      W = 1 2mv2 − 1 2mv2 0 W = 1 2 m v 2 − 1 2 m v 0 2. This expression is called the work-energy theorem, and it actually applies in general (even for forces that vary in direction and magnitude), although we have derived it for the special case of a constant force parallel to the displacement.

      Who was the first person to use the word energy?

      Thomas Young, the first person to use the term “energy” in the modern sense. The word energy derives from the Ancient Greek: ἐνέργεια, romanized : energeia, lit. ‘activity, operation’, which possibly appears for the first time in the work of Aristotle in the 4th century BC.
